IvorySQL3.0: Basierend auf dem neuesten Kernel von PG16.0, ist es mit der Oracle-Datenbank kompatibel und wird dann aktualisiert.

Als einer der weltweit größten Datenbankanbieter verfügt Oracle über eine hohe Marktpräsenz und einen hohen Marktanteil. Mit der steigenden Nachfrage nach Datenverarbeitung stehen Unternehmen, die Oracle verwenden, jedoch möglicherweise vor einigen Herausforderungen, wie z. B. Datenbankkomplexität, hohe Wartungskosten, Probleme bei der Datenmigration und -integration usw., die es schwierig machen, die Echtzeit-Datenverarbeitungsanforderungen des Unternehmens zu erfüllen Dies führt zu einer vorzeitigen und inkonsistenten Datenverarbeitung. Genauigkeit und andere Probleme. Daher benötigen Unternehmen effizientere, flexiblere und Echtzeit-Datenverarbeitungslösungen, um den ständig wachsenden Datenverarbeitungsanforderungen gerecht zu werden. An diesem Punkt steht Unternehmen eine kostengünstige Alternative zu Oracle zur Verfügung, die von großer und weitreichender Bedeutung ist, um den Weg für zukünftige Verbesserungen zu klären.

Als Antwort auf diese Herausforderungen bietet IvorySQL eine Lösung auf Basis von PostgreSQL, der weltweit fortschrittlichsten Open-Source-Datenbank, mit maximaler Kompatibilität mit Oracle und besseren Datenbankmigrationsdiensten. Wenn Sie sich für IvorySQL entscheiden, können Sie nicht nur Kompatibilität mit Oracle erreichen und Migrationskosten und -risiken reduzieren, sondern auch die hervorragende Leistung und Stabilität, Skalierbarkeit und bessere Datenbankkompatibilität, praktische und umfangreiche Verwaltungsfunktionen und -tools sowie Open Source- und Community-Unterstützung und mehr genießen Vorteile.

Bisher hat IvorySQL 10 Versionen erfolgreich veröffentlicht. Die neueste Version von IvorySQL3.0 basiert auf dem neuesten PostgreSQL16.0-Kernel und erweitert weitere Funktionen auf Unternehmensebene. Im Vergleich zur PostgreSQL Community Edition hat 3.0 die Oracle-Kompatibilität und Benutzerfreundlichkeit deutlich verbessert und bietet umfassendere Unterstützung für die Anpassung an Containerisierungs- und Cloud-Umgebungen. Darüber hinaus verfügt es über umfassendere Features und innovative Funktionen sowie ein hohes Maß an SQL- und PL/SQL-Kompatibilität .

#1 Gesamtarchitektur von IvorySQL3.0

IvorySQL3.0 verfügt über umfangreiche Funktionen und Kerntechnologien, darunter Kompatibilität, hohe Leistung, sicheren Zugriff auf heterogene Datenbanken und andere Funktionen. Die Gesamtarchitektur ist in der folgenden Abbildung dargestellt.

Abbildung 1 Gesamtarchitektur von IvorySQL3.0

IvorySQL3.0 implementiert mit Oracle kompatible Funktionen basierend auf dem Prinzip der Minimierung der Unterschiede zu PostgreSQL. Es empfängt externe Anfragen durch die Implementierung von Dual-Parsern und Dual-Ports und erweitert das PL/iSQL-Framework basierend auf der ursprünglichen Architektur. Gleichzeitig wird die Kompatibilitätsfunktion über das Plug-In IvorySQL_ORA implementiert. Dieses Design ermöglicht es 3.0, ähnliche Funktionen und Verhaltensweisen wie Oracle Database bereitzustellen und gleichzeitig die Kompatibilität mit PostgreSQL aufrechtzuerhalten. Auf diese Weise kann IvorySQL3.0 Benutzern flexiblere und effizientere Datenbanklösungen bieten.

#2 Oracle-Kompatibilität

>>>Umfassendere Oracle-Kompatibilität

Um Benutzern eine reibungslosere Migration zu IvorySQL zu erleichtern, haben wir in der neuen Version 3.0 mehrere Kompatibilitäts-Upgrade-Funktionen hinzugefügt:

1) In Bezug auf die SQL-Kompatibilität ist es neu kompatibel mit dem Oracle MERGE-Befehl, Oracle q Escape und Oracle like.

2) Im Hinblick auf die PL/SQL-Kompatibilität werden neue anonyme Oracle-Blöcke hinzugefügt, um die Probleme beim Erstellen von Funktionen/gespeicherten Prozeduren in PL/SQL zu lösen und die Erstellung von Funktionen oder Prozeduren im SQL-Parser zu unterstützen, um verschachtelte Unterprozesse zu unterstützen.

3) Neu hinzugefügte Kompatibilität mit dem btree_gist-Index, Kompatibilität mit dem btree_gin-Index, Kompatibilität mit integrierten Oracle-Datentypen und integrierten Funktionen.

4) Darüber hinaus wird der Aktion eine Meson-Kompilierung hinzugefügt, und kompatible Testfälle, Contrib-Regression, Oracle-Datentyp-GIN-Indexoperation, Oracle-Datentyp-Gist-Indexoperation und PL/iSQL-Erweiterung werden hinzugefügt.

#3 Hauptmerkmale von IvorySQL3.0

>>>IvorySQL3.0 verwendet den Multiprozessmodus, um die Stabilität und Skalierbarkeit der Datenbank unter Bedingungen hoher Parallelität sicherzustellen. Nachdem der Client durch Authentifizierung und Authentifizierung eine Verbindung mit dem Daemon hergestellt hat, interagiert er mit dem gemeinsam genutzten Speicherbereich der Datenbankinstanz. Hintergrundprozesse wie Hintergrundschreibprozesse, Protokollschreibprozesse, Statuserfassungsprozesse und automatische Bereinigungsprozesse behalten die Speicherstruktur der Datenbankinstanz bei und gewährleisten die Zugriffsleistung und Datensicherheit der Datenbank. Durch die kooperative Arbeit dieser Hintergrundprozesse bleibt IvorySQL3.0 bei der Verarbeitung einer großen Anzahl gleichzeitiger Anforderungen effizient und stabil.

>>>Darüber hinaus führt IvorySQL3.0 einen Dual-Port-Servicemodus ein, unterstützt die Dual-Parser-Architektur und kombiniert effektiv Oracle-Kompatibilitätsfunktionen und native PostgreSQL-Funktionen. Dieses Design ermöglicht es IvorySQL 3.0, die native Funktionalität von PostgreSQL beizubehalten und gleichzeitig Oracle-kompatible Funktionalität bereitzustellen. Um die Kompatibilität mit Oracle zu verbessern, bietet IvorySQL3.0 auch ein PL/iSQL-Sprachverarbeitungsmodul. Dieses modulare Design gewährleistet eine perfekte Integration mit PostgreSQL und verbessert gleichzeitig die Oracle-Kompatibilität.

>>>IvorySQL3.0 erbt nicht nur alle hervorragenden Funktionen traditioneller relationaler Datenbanken, wie z. B. die strikte Befolgung des ACID-Prinzips, sondern erfüllt auch Branchen und Branchen mit hohen Anforderungen an die Transaktionsverarbeitung durch die Einführung von Multi-Version Concurrency Control (MVCC) und Transaktionsprotokollen und Constraint-Technologie. Szenen. Gleichzeitig integriert IvorySQL3.0 durch die native Unterstützung von JSON/JSONB die Flexibilität von NoSQL und bietet vielfältigere Datenspeicheroptionen. Dieses einzigartige Design ermöglicht es IvorySQL3.0, sich an die vielfältigen Anforderungen moderner Anwendungen zur Datenspeicherung anzupassen und gleichzeitig die leistungsstarken Funktionen relationaler Datenbanken beizubehalten und Benutzern eine flexible und effiziente Datenbanklösung zu bieten.

#4 IvorySQL3.0 Open-Source-Cloud-Plattform

Durch die Integration von Open-Source-Cloud-Plattformen kann IvorySQL3.0 flexiblere und effizientere Datenbanklösungen bereitstellen. Die grafische Oberfläche der Open-Source-Cloud-Plattform ermöglicht Benutzern den Aufbau einer IvorySQL-Datenbank mit einem Klick und bietet intuitive Verwaltungs- und Überwachungstools. Die Open-Source-Cloud-Plattform vereinfacht mühsame Vorgänge wie Datenbankbereitstellung, Sicherung und Wiederherstellung sowie Festplattenerweiterung, sorgt so für eine angemessene Ressourcenplanung und -zuweisung und bietet Benutzern eine praktische, effiziente und leicht zu wartende Datenbanklösung.

>>>Kommende Funktionen der Open-Source-Cloud-Plattform

>>>Zukunftsausblick:

In Zukunft wird IvorySQL nicht nur ein relationales Open-Source-Datenbanksystem sein, sondern sein Ökosystem wird auch mehrere Cloud-bezogene Open-Source-Projekte umfassen.

Beispielsweise wird sich das Projekt Ivory-Operator der Realisierung der automatisierten Bereitstellung und des Betriebs von IvorySQL in der Kubernetes-Umgebung widmen, während das Projekt Ivory-containers verschiedene Tools und Vorlagen bereitstellen wird, die zum Ausführen von IvorySQL in einer Containerumgebung erforderlich sind.

Darüber hinaus passt sich Hancos serverloses System HGNeon auch an IvorySQL3.0 an und bietet eine serverlose Lösung auf Basis von IvorySQL. Der Start dieser Projekte wird den Anwendungsbereich von IvorySQL erheblich erweitern und Benutzern bequemere, effizientere und flexiblere Datenbankdienste bieten.

#5 Schreiben Sie am Ende

IvorySQL3.0 ist ein Produkt, das vom Kern-F&E-Team von Hangao Co., Ltd. speziell für Benutzer entwickelt wurde. Es basiert auf eingehender Forschung und Beherrschung des neuesten Kernels von PostgreSQL16.0 und integriert die langjährige Erfahrung des Unternehmens in der Entwicklung und Betrieb und Wartung der Oracle-Datenbankkompatibilitätsfunktionen. Eine relationale Open-Source-Datenbank, die für das OLTP-Kerngeschäft entwickelt wurde. Derzeit hat IvorySQL erfolgreich den Weg lokalisierter alternativer Technologien auf Basis von Open-Source-Datenbankprodukten erkundet und die neue Praxis der Entfernung von „O“ aus Kerngeschäftssystemen in der Finanzbranche abgeschlossen.

An dieser Stelle danken wir allen Benutzern und Entwicklern aufrichtig für ihren herausragenden Beitrag und ihre kontinuierliche Unterstützung bei der Entwicklung der Version IvorySQL 3.0, die die Verwendung von IvorySQL einfacher macht. In Zukunft werden wir weiterhin Produkt- und Community-Ökosysteme aufbauen, Partner ausbauen und gemeinsam den Wohlstand und die Entwicklung des Community-Ökosystems fördern. Bieten Sie Benutzern qualitativ hochwertigere, effizientere und sicherere Produkte und Dienstleistungen und hören Sie gleichzeitig aktiv auf die Bedürfnisse und Stimmen von Benutzern und Entwicklern und reagieren Sie darauf. Fördern Sie gemeinsam die digitale Transformation von Unternehmen und bauen Sie eine effizientere, stabilere und flexiblere Lösung zur reibungslosen „O“-Entfernung auf.

>>>Erleben Sie jetzt IvorySQL 3.0

Klicken Sie auf den „Link“ am Ende des Artikels, um mit der Erkundung der Versionshinweise zu IvorySQL3.0 zu beginnen und mehr über weitere exklusive Funktionen zu erfahren.

GitHub-Link:

https://github.com/IvorySQL/IvorySQL

Gitee-Link:

https://gitee.com/IvorySQL/IvorySQL
 

Microsoft startet neue „Windows-App“ Xiaomi gibt offiziell bekannt, dass Xiaomi Vela vollständig Open Source ist und der zugrunde liegende Kernel NuttX Vite 5 ist . Alibaba Cloud 11.12 wurde offiziell veröffentlicht. Die Ursache des Fehlers wurde offengelegt: Anomalie des Access Key-Dienstes (Access Key). . GitHub-Bericht: TypeScript ersetzt Java und wird zum drittbeliebtesten. Die wundersame Operation des Sprachoperators: das Netzwerk im Hintergrund trennen, Breitbandkonten deaktivieren, Benutzer zum Wechseln optischer Modems zwingen ByteDance: Verwendung von KI zur automatischen Optimierung der Linux-Kernel-Parameter Microsoft Open Source Terminal Chat Spring Framework 6.1 offiziell GA OpenAI, ehemaliger CEO und Präsident Sam Altman & Greg Brockman, wechselt zu Microsoft
{{o.name}}
{{m.name}}

Supongo que te gusta

Origin my.oschina.net/u/5729420/blog/10149529
Recomendado
Clasificación